Verdict

Genetic Counselor earns more on average โ€” the national median is $2,028/year (2%) higher than a Registered Nurse. However, salaries vary significantly by city, employer, and experience level โ€” see the city-by-city breakdown below.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does a Registered Nurse or Genetic Counselor earn more?+

A Genetic Counselor earns more on average. The national median salary for a Registered Nurse is $97,550/year, compared to $99,578/year for a Genetic Counselor โ€” a difference of $2,028 (2%).

Which has better career growth โ€” Registered Nurse or Genetic Counselor?+

Registered Nurse roles are growing at 6% YoY while Genetic Counselor demand is growing at 18% YoY. Genetic Counselor has stronger near-term demand growth.
